* [[Camp Cook]]: Ship's cook, actually, but Lanier still fits the trope in every other way. It's noted repeatedly that his "station" during combat operations is hiding in the toilet... until he calmly, without flair [[Took a Level In Badass|turns into a badass]] in ''Firestorm'' by emerging from belowdecks and hosing down a pterodactyl with a tommygun at face-to-face range.
** In ''Deadly Shores'' he displays [[Hidden Depths]]: first, when {{Spoiler|Chief Gray is killed}}, Captain Reddy notices "the bloated, cantankerous cook's grimy face was streaked with tears." Then, in the aftermath, Lanier is mentioned as helping lay out the bodies of his shipmates "with an unexpected tenderness."
